What Was ZeenoAI?
ZeenoAI launched in early 2023 as a mobile AI assistant embedded directly within your keyboard. The startup's core idea? Help users draft emails, rewrite texts, brainstorm tweets, and conduct research—all without leaving their messaging or note-taking apps.
Think Grammarly meets ChatGPT, bundled inside your smartphone keyboard.
Founded by three University of British Columbia graduates—Enrique Moran, Callum Woznow, and Sophie Berger—ZeenoAI raised $840,000 in May 2023 from Neo, a well-known San Francisco-based venture capital fund. That same year, it garnered attention on Product Hunt with user-friendly features and roadmap teasers that included integrations with payment platforms and calendar apps.
By mid-2023, it was featured as one of the most promising productivity tools, receiving glowing reviews and favorable comparisons to other AI-enhanced tools.

Why Did ZeenoAI Fail?
Short Answer:
ZeenoAI failed because it couldn’t sustain its growth in an overcrowded market, struggled with monetization, and quickly lost momentum against feature-rich competitors—and possibly, internal pivot or shutdown decisions that never made headlines.
Long Answer:
Now, let’s break down the deeper reasons behind ZeenoAI’s quiet demise.
- Crowded and Cutthroat Market
- The AI keyboard assistant category got packed fast. Alternatives like GPTKey, Baron AI, Mouseless, and TypeAce competed for the same users. Meanwhile, Big Tech companies began embedding AI directly into mobile operating systems—diminishing the appeal of third-party keyboard plugins.
- When Apple, Google, and Microsoft start offering baked-in AI writing tools, independent apps lose their niche fast.
- Monetization Woes
- Despite decent visibility out the gate, ZeenoAI offered most of its functionality for free or with limited monetization strategies. Simply embedding GPT-like features in a keyboard wasn’t enough to generate steady revenue, especially when OpenAI itself kept launching new, free tools for similar use cases.
- There was no clear premium strategy or enterprise tier, and no strong community of paying subscribers emerged.
- Underwhelming User Adoption
- Some friction was built into the product itself: enabling “full access” permissions for the AI keyboard raised privacy concerns—a big red flag for cautious users.
- Despite positive initial reviews, Zeeno didn’t seem to gain breakout traction beyond early adopters on Product Hunt and Twitter. Without wide adoption, the operational costs likely outweighed any returns.
- Limited Funding and Growth Pressure
- $840,000 was enough to build an MVP and gain traction but not nearly enough to scale globally, develop complex integrations, or hire a robust team.
- Unlike AI unicorns that raised tens of millions in 2023–2024, ZeenoAI likely struggled to secure follow-on funding amid fierce investor scrutiny and macroeconomic belt-tightening.
- Lack of Differentiation
- ZeenoAI promised calendar and payments integration, but these features were either never fully shipped or failed to significantly enhance the core product.
- Competitors moved faster or with more precision. GPTKey, for example, honed in on ultra-smooth GPT-4 integrations and leveraged OpenAI’s APIs more creatively.
- Possibly a Quiet Wind-Down
- While no official press release or announcement confirmed ZeenoAI’s shutdown, the signs were there. The website went offline. Social media activity ceased. No new updates were posted in 2024. Even fan chatter died out.
- In startup land, lack of noise usually equals death. It’s possible the founders chose to sunset the app quietly, rather than pursue an acquisition or keep it on life support.
ZeenoAI vs. GPTKey: Who Did It Better?
If you’re wondering who won the AI-keyboard game, look no further than GPTKey. Both apps launched in similar timeframes and offered AI-generated text on mobile keyboards. But GPTKey outlasted ZeenoAI—here’s why:
- Sharper Focus: GPTKey kept its scope narrow and refined—better prompts, fewer bugs, smoother UX.
- Continuous Improvement: GPTKey pushed consistent updates, leaned into user feedback, and even introduced pro-tier pricing before Zeeno could finish its roadmap.
- Better Timing: GPTKey aligned itself closely with OpenAI’s GPT churn. Every time ChatGPT improved, GPTKey rode the wave. ZeenoAI couldn’t keep pace.
